## Authentication

Heads up: the nightly reindex job (`reindex_nightly.py`) talks to the Lanternfish search cluster, and that cluster won't accept anonymous writes anymore — we locked it down last sprint. The job now authenticates as the `reindex-runner` service identity against Corvid Gateway, and the token is injected via the `LF_INDEX_TOKEN` env var in the scheduler config. Nothing clever going on, just a bearer header on every batch request. For review purposes, the staging credential currently in use is listed below.

service key, kadug-kadup: kto15_rN23XLAYImmZgrJ

Subject: On-call handover — cron migration

Handing off mid-migration: roughly half the nightly cron jobs now run on the Driftway workflow engine. The remaining jobs are listed in the migration sheet, with three flagged as flaky on retry. Nothing is paging right now. If a Driftway task stalls past its deadline, don't re-run the legacy cron; instead contact the platform workflows group.

escalation mailbox, bafog-fafog: ulador@paliqlabs.internal

**Ticket: Waveform preview config drift**

Plugin authors targeting the Soundloom preview API should be aware that the waveform rendering service has drifted from its documented configuration. The sample bucket size and peak normalization settings in production no longer match the published defaults, so previews generated locally may look coarser than those rendered server-side. We will reconcile this in the next release. For reference, the production service is currently running with the following values:

config for kafof-bawef:
holath:
  log_level: debug
  metrics_host: metrics.holath.qorvelsys.internal
  pin: 2191
  pool_size: 32